Final preparations underway for Cwmcarn Forest Drive reopening in 2021

Natural Resources Wales (NRW) has announced that the highly anticipated redevelopment of Cwmcarn Forest Drive has taken another step closer to completion.

This final task to resurface the drive is underway and follows months of work to create eight exciting new recreational areas along the drive. The stop off points along the seven-mile-long drive will offer something for everyone – from families with little explorers to seasoned ramblers looking for a tranquil spot for a brew with a view. These include three new play areas, a storytelling area, learning facilities, all-ability trails, and several new seating areas and picnic spots.
The partnership project between NRW and Caerphilly County Borough Council to reopen Cwmcarn Forest Drive has received significant investment and is something which has been greatly anticipated by many.

Due to concerns around the current rise of covid-19 cases, it is hoped that the new drive will be open for a trial period mid-March with a view to the drive being officially reopened in the Easter holidays 2021.
